Well, So I went and got a brand new sonata lastnight, we love the car. We had a 2004 toyota matrix that kept falling apart. So anyway, my question is, does the stock stereo in the sonata have any outputs like pre-amp outputs. I kept my system I had in my matrix so was wanting to put it in the new car. Im trying to see if theres a way to hook up my amp and sub box without having to buy anything or hoping the stock stereo has RCA amp outputs. Any info would be appreciated, Thank you

Several stereo head units were offered on the 2008 Sonata, but all appear to have been made by Infinity and all have a similar layout. The attachment is the connector schematic for the 6 CD/XM version. None have RCA connectors for the purpose you describe. The system already has an external amplifier.
